ARTHREX IOT SPORTS STUDY GUIDE
EXAM UPDATED QUESTIONS AND
CORRECT ANSWERS.




What is the primary function of the Subscapularis muscle? - ANS Internal Rotation


True or False: Proximal refers to being closer to the main mass of the body - ANS True


The Quadriceps Femoris refers to: - ANS 1. Rectus Femoris
2. Vastus Lateralis
3. Vastus Medialis
4. Vastus Intermedius


Which is the most common ligament disruption involved in lateral ankle sprains? - ANS ATFL:
Anterior Talo-Fibular Ligament


What are complications of screw fixation for syndesmosis injury? - ANS 1. Loosening
2. Breakage
3. Need of second operation


What is the strongest ligament in the ankle syndesmotic ligament complex? - ANS PiTFL:
Posterior Inferior Tibiofibular Ligament

, What 3 bones make up the ankle joint? - ANS 1. Talus
2. Tibia
3. Fibula


What are the two nerves most at risk when surgeons perform lateral ankle ligament
operations? - ANS 1. Sural Nerve
2. Superficial Peroneal Nerve


What is the major advantage of DualWave pump over traditional inflow only pump? -
ANS DualWave pumps automatically regulate inflow and outflow to maintain constant fluid
pressure in the joint


What percentage does plasma make up of whole blood? - ANS 55%


Which ligament doesn't support ankle the syndesmosis joint? - ANS Doesn't: ATFL
Do: PiTFL
AiTFL
Tibiofibular Interosseous Ligament


SpeedBridge RCR consists of how many medial and lateral anchors? - ANS 2 Medial and 2
Lateral


What is the primary function of the supraspinatus muscle? - ANS Abduction (move away
from the body)


Synergy UHD4 4K imaging console has ___ times the resolution as standard HD - ANS 4


What is the most common motion responsible for lateral ankle sprains? - ANS Inversion and
Plantar Flexion
